El inusual turismo iraní se consolida en las playas turcas
🏖️ Iranian tourists hit a record of 1.75 million visitors to Turkey's beaches in the first seven months of 2024, a 40% increase from the previous year. Iranians are now the fifth largest tourist group in Turkey, behind Russians, Germans, British, and Bulgarians. Over half a million Ukrainians vacationed in Turkey despite the war, while tourism from Israel plunged 90% to just 45,000. Chinese and American visitors surged to 230,000 and 770,000, respectively. Overall, Turkey's tourism grew by 8% during this period, aided by the local currency's sharp decline.
